Transaction 576deea42fafdfbd5ed8e48858cedc6c72549ffe9b20858179dc8e5e512224bf

3 Input
2 Outputs
  • 576deea42fafdfbd5ed8e48858cedc6c72549ffe9b20858179dc8e5e512224bf:0
  • value  1847456
    address  37ssBASUvb6JLCcprs1LZwx6SMi7Jyggjv
  • 576deea42fafdfbd5ed8e48858cedc6c72549ffe9b20858179dc8e5e512224bf:1
  • value  12263000
    address  1815AFQbhJRnmjizMHg6pn2BwSVKvXcZ5c